Linear/Non-linear Composite Material Property Calculation Software Digimat
Micro-mechanical modeling software for composites developed by Belgium's e-Xstreem Engineering 【Features】 Obtaining the material properties of composites is challenging due to the combination of different materials, but DIGIMAT calculates the material properties of linear/non-linear composites using the latest micro-modeling technology. The software consists of the DIGIMAT core (material property homogenization module IMAT Standalone), which calculates material properties, and an interface module that connects with CAE software. The DIGIMAT core evaluates the behavior characteristics of heterogeneous/an isotropic materials such as polymer matrix composites (PMC), rubber matrix composites (RMC), and metal matrix composites (MMC) using the latest material property homogenization technology. The interface module takes into account the final material structure resulting from the process during finite element analysis, enabling accurate and efficient multi-scale modeling of materials and structures. ● For other functions and details, please download the catalog.

A piezoelectric material is a dielectric that converts mechanical energy into electrical energy, or vice versa. In this case, force is applied to the upper surface of a cylindrical piezoelectric material, and the resulting voltage is analyzed. Since the equations related to "force" and "electricity" are different, these equations are coupled to analyze the piezoelectric element. Therefore, a coupled analysis of stress and electric field was conducted. The software used for stress analysis and electric field analysis is PHOTO-ELAS and PHOTO-VOLT, respectively. 【Case Overview】 ■ Software Used: PHOTO-ELAS and PHOTO-VOLT ■ Analysis Conditions - Relative Permittivity: 2000 - Young's Modulus: 5×10^10 - Poisson's Ratio: 0.35 - Analysis Modules: VOLT & ELAS *For more details, please refer to the related links or feel free to contact us.

It is possible to perform stability calculations for the drainage basins of reinforced and unreinforced concrete both under normal conditions and during earthquakes, as well as stress checks for all 12 sections of the bottom slab and side walls. In the earthquake analysis, considerations for "dynamic water pressure" and "inertial forces due to self-weight" can be included. The analysis of the side walls can be selected from "horizontal stress analysis," "three-edge fixed slab method," or "both ends fixed beam + three-edge fixed slab." Additionally, up to six combinations of load cases are possible. Output reports can be previewed for content confirmation, and Word output is also available.
